Tom's Note
반응형
[리눅스] 사용자 관리
리눅스 2022. 4. 25. 21:17

사용자 분류 리눅스는 크게 root 사용자와 일반 사용자로 구분됩니다. 또, 일반 사용자는 로그인 가능한 사용자와 로그인 되지 않는 시스템 계정을 구분됩니다. 모든 권한을 가진 root : Privileged User 또는 Super User라고 부릅니다. 리눅스 시스템은 ID로 관리하는 것이 아닌 UID 즉, 숫자값의 형태로 관리되어집니다. 0번 : root ~ 999번까지 시스템계정 1000번 부터 사용자 계정 리눅스 배포판 마다 UID 사용 범위는 조금 다릅니다. (거의 옛 버전이 500번까지 최근 버전은 1000번대입니다) 사용자 관련 명령어 계정 생성 : useradd, adduser 계정 관리 : usermod 계정 삭제 : userdel 계정 암호 : passwd, pwconv, pwunco..

article thumbnail
[리눅스/명령어] 패스워드 날짜에 특화된 chage
리눅스/명령어 2021. 10. 11. 14:43

일반적으로 chage의 쓰임새는 일반 사용자가 자기의 패스워드와 관련된 날짜와 관련된 정보를 파악하기 위함이다. 만료날짜, 만료경고 날짜, 패스워드 변경 후 언제까지 접속을 해야하는 날짜 등등 하지만 일반사용자들은 자기 id의 정보확인만 가능하다. chage를 통해 설정값을 변경하기 위해서는 root권한이 필요하거나 임명을 해야 설정할 수 있게 된다. 위 "chage --help"에서 일반사용자들은 -l, --list만 사용할 수 있다.(단, 자기 계정만 확인가능) 위 그림을 보면 내 계정은 "whoami"를 통해 "cba"라는 계정임을 알 수 있고, "chage -l cba"를 통해 cba의 관한 패스워드 날짜 목록들을 확인할 수 있다.

반응형